London Gazette notice
Order of the British Empire
Civil Division
Central Chancery of the Orders of Knighthood
St. James’s Palace, London SW1
31 December 2016
THE QUEEN has been graciously pleased to give orders for the following promotions in, and appointments to the Most Excellent Order of the British Empire:
M.B.E.
To be Ordinary Members of the Civil Division of the said Most Excellent Order:
Alan Robert MOTION
Chair, Institute of Chartered Foresters Examination Board
For services to Sustainable Forestry and Arboriculture.
Source: The London Gazette, issue 61803 · Crown copyright, Open Government Licence v3.0
